Picture: Boris SV/ Minute/ Getty ImagesRecommended Articles The cost to set up a fencing can vary based upon the amount of product used, which is, in large part, determined by the size of your fence. Longer fences will naturally set you back even more due to higher material expenses and labor prices to install them.


These numbers can differ based on the format and topography of your property - Rail fence installation Knoxville TN. Lot SizeLinear FeetAverage Fence Cost1/8 acre150$3,5001/ 4 acre220$4,8501/ 2 acre590$13,5701 acre1,100$24,0002 acres2,200$45,000 The kind of fencing you pick is an additional important aspect influencing price. For circumstances, if you intend to block the sight of your yard entirely, a personal privacy fencing expenses around $35 per straight foot.

Fence installation business base their rates on the neighborhood marketand their rivals. Areas with a higher price of living, such as booming cities and suburban areas, will likely suggest your neighborhood fence specialist will certainly charge more for their labor and fencing materials.


If you live in a location with several HOAs, you might pay even more for those fencing products because of high demand. Vinyl fence installation Knoxville TN. If you're replacing a fence as opposed to mounting a new one, you'll need to get rid of the old one prior to you can begin your setup. Fence elimination costs $3 to $5 per linear, with the majority of spending $450 to $750 to remove 150 feet of secure fencing.


Recommended Articles Installing a fencing on a slope is much more costly and taxing, either because the land needs leveling or due to the fact that your fence installer requires to manipulate the fence products to straighten with the slope and still protect your lawn. Sometimes, you might only be able to mount your fence if you pay for leveling.
